b. Slide the handlebar grip over the left end
of the handlebar.
TIP
Make sure that the distance "a" between the end
of the left handlebar switch and the end of the
handlebar grip is 0 mm (0 in).
1
c. Wipe off any excess rubber adhesive with
a clean rag.
EWA13700
WARNING
Do not touch the handlebar grip until the rub-
ber adhesive has fully dried.
d. Install the left grip end.
Grip end bolt (left)
7 N·m (0.7 kgf·m, 5.2 lb·ft)
TIP
There should be 1.0–5.0 mm (0.04–0.20 in) of
clearance "a" between the handlebar grip and
the grip end.

EAS32356
INSTALLING THE UPPER HANDLEBAR
COVER
1. Install:
• Upper handlebar cover "1"
• Upper handlebar panel "2"
a. Fit the projections "a" on the upper handle-
bar cover into the holes "b" in the lower
handlebar cover.
a
4-77
TIP
There should be 0.5–4.0 mm (0.02–0.16 in) of
clearance "c" between the upper handlebar cov-
er and handlebar switch.
1
a
1
c
b. Install the quick fasteners and upper han-
dlebar cover screws, and then tighten the
screws to specification.
Upper handlebar cover screw
1.8 N·m (0.18 kgf·m, 1.3 lb·ft)
